#4f4e4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f4e4e is composed of 31% red, 30.6%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 0.6% and a lightness of 30.8%. #4f4e4e color hex could be obtained by blending #9e9c9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#4f4e4e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f4e4e has RGB values of R:79, G:78,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.01,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5197390.
